diff options
author | bors-servo <lbergstrom+bors@mozilla.com> | 2018-01-22 11:11:44 -0600 |
---|---|---|
committer | GitHub <noreply@github.com> | 2018-01-22 11:11:44 -0600 |
commit | c1ed4bb2d5ed6a4f9967215620d2105cda5ef76a (patch) | |
tree | 3cea287720d2e343b5a78ed03af137397d48fdf6 /components/script/dom/vreyeparameters.rs | |
parent | abb04ce7c6d68bd6fa24d39692d2884c6cbc371d (diff) | |
parent | 4be30960400dc25c68d7d0cb8da2de3cc4682b56 (diff) | |
download | servo-c1ed4bb2d5ed6a4f9967215620d2105cda5ef76a.tar.gz servo-c1ed4bb2d5ed6a4f9967215620d2105cda5ef76a.zip |
Auto merge of #19829 - servo:rustup, r=nox
Update Rust and use the newly-stable std::ptr::NonNull
<!-- Reviewable:start -->
This change is [<img src="https://reviewable.io/review_button.svg" height="34" align="absmiddle" alt="Reviewable"/>](https://reviewable.io/reviews/servo/servo/19829)
<!-- Reviewable:end -->
Diffstat (limited to 'components/script/dom/vreyeparameters.rs')
-rw-r--r-- | components/script/dom/vreyeparameters.rs |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/components/script/dom/vreyeparameters.rs b/components/script/dom/vreyeparameters.rs index 496277ba65d..333c717f06b 100644 --- a/components/script/dom/vreyeparameters.rs +++ b/components/script/dom/vreyeparameters.rs @@ -5,7 +5,6 @@ use dom::bindings::cell::DomRefCell; use dom::bindings::codegen::Bindings::VREyeParametersBinding; use dom::bindings::codegen::Bindings::VREyeParametersBinding::VREyeParametersMethods; -use dom::bindings::nonnull::NonNullJSObjectPtr; use dom::bindings::reflector::{Reflector, reflect_dom_object}; use dom::bindings::root::{Dom, DomRoot}; use dom::globalscope::GlobalScope; @@ -15,6 +14,7 @@ use js::jsapi::{Heap, JSContext, JSObject}; use js::typedarray::{Float32Array, CreateWith}; use std::default::Default; use std::ptr; +use std::ptr::NonNull; use webvr_traits::WebVREyeParameters; #[dom_struct] @@ -60,8 +60,8 @@ impl VREyeParameters { impl VREyeParametersMethods for VREyeParameters { #[allow(unsafe_code)] // https://w3c.github.io/webvr/#dom-vreyeparameters-offset - unsafe fn Offset(&self, _cx: *mut JSContext) -> NonNullJSObjectPtr { - NonNullJSObjectPtr::new_unchecked(self.offset.get()) + unsafe fn Offset(&self, _cx: *mut JSContext) -> NonNull<JSObject> { + NonNull::new_unchecked(self.offset.get()) } // https://w3c.github.io/webvr/#dom-vreyeparameters-fieldofview |